Hunmanby, a delightful village nestled in North Yorkshire, is served by its very own train station, aptly named Hunmanby Train Station. It's a quaint spot that supports local travel needs, conveniently connecting residents and visitors with various attractions and destinations in the region. For those contemplating a visit or travel through Hunmanby Station, here's what you need to know.
Although modest in size and services, Hunmanby Train Station offers essential facilities for travelers. While there isn't a ticket office on-site, passengers can collect their pre-purchased tickets using an accessible ticket machine located on Platform 2. For your auditory needs, an induction loop is in place. If you're planning your travel, the station ensures accessibility with step-free access to platforms via a level crossing ramp, making it convenient for all passengers, including those with wheelchairs.
For those in need of assistance, note that the station is unstaffed. However, customer help points are available, and you can contact the helpline at 08002006060 for support. Additionally, boarding ramps are carried on all trains arriving at the station. Whether it's last-minute travel arrangements or assistance bookings, they can be made up to 2 hours before your journey.
Hunmanby Station integrates well with other transport modes. While there are no buses directly servicing the station, Rail Replacement Services are accessible nearby for those needing to travel when regular services are disrupted. Should you choose to grab a cab, explore options through Northern Railway's Cab4You service, which can be handy for quick and direct transport solutions.

Nestled in the serene setting of East Sussex, Doleham Train Station offers a peaceful gateway to the broader rail network within the UK. Whether you're commuting, visiting friends, or simply exploring new landscapes, you'll find Doleham Station a convenient starting point for your travels. Whilst it may be small, the station's quaint characteristics embody the charm of rural England blending seamlessly with modern train travel. Doleham station might lack some of the larger transport hub's facilities but it compensates with a unique rural charm and simplicity that surely enhances one's travel experience.
Despite its size, Doleham Station is equipped with essential amenities to make your journey smooth. Travelers can find ticket machines that facilitate not only the collection of pre-booked tickets but also offer the convenience of purchasing tickets directly. Plus, these machines have accessible designs, although potential visitors should ensure the location is suitable before arriving. Disabled Persons Railcard discounts can be applied when purchasing from these machines. For assistance, help points dotted around the platform can provide immediate support when needed.
For those needing a visual overview of train schedules, Doleham Station offers departure screens, and announcements to keep you updated as you anticipate your journey. While there are no waiting rooms, ample seating is available for those short waits between arrivals and departures. The station prides itself on providing step-free access throughout, ensuring everyone can board and alight with ease. Although it lacks facilities like ATMs, shops, or refreshment facilities, it's the ideal station if you're after a quiet and less hectic departure point.
Making travel seamless, Doleham Train Station offers rail replacement services for those inevitable days when trains are unavailable. Details about these services can be discovered quickly, ensuring your journey remains on track. For local trips, information on bus services is accessible via the "Onward Travel Information Map" section. While there might not be a dedicated taxi rank or car hire directly onsite, a short journey into the local town opens up a myriad of options for further transportation.
